Mappila Pattu (also spelled Mappilappattu) are songs in Malayalam and Arabi-Malayalam performed by the Muslim community of Kerala. They range from devotional (naat, manqabat) to romantic, historical, and social themes. The tunes often use pentatonic scales, distinct rhythmic cycles, and a call-and-response structure that makes them ideal for mixing into medleys.
